Scope of this article

Question.svg This talk page or section has a conflict or a question that needs to be answered. Please try to help and resolve the issue by leaving a comment.

This article has "everything but the kitchen sink" syndrome; only the Yoshi's Island DS enemy is confirmed to have this name, and it has a distinct appearance: white outfit with a bandana of a varying singular color. However, instead of limiting it to just that, this wiki considers "Pirate Guy" to be a catch-all term for any Shy Guy in pirate garb, including:

  • The Yoshi's Story enemies, which appearance-wise are just normal Shy Guys wearing blue-and-orange striped bandanas (or a pirate hat in the case of what is presumably their captain) that attack from a pirate ship in the background. They also have a different Japanese name.
  • The Mario Kart enemies from Shy Guy Beach, which have no confirmed name in Japanese or English but are pretty similar to the Yoshi's Story ones, though their bandanas are plain blue and they fire cannonballs instead of Bob-ombs.
  • The Shy Guys from Shy Guy Says and Flagging Rights in the Mario Party series, which are only ever called "Shy Guy." The one from the first Mario Party wears a full pirate outfit, while the ones from 8, Top 100, and Superstars only have a hat.

Just like with Aqua Kuribō and Goomdiver or Putrid Piranha and Poison Piranha Plant, conceptual similarity between these subjects does not make them all the same thing. There is no doubt in my mind that this should be split. The only question is exactly how to split it. Dark BonesSig.png 17:14, June 30, 2021 (EDT)

Clean up this article

Proposal.svg This talk page section contains an unresolved talk page proposal. Please try to help and resolve the issue by voting or leaving a comment.

Current time: Tuesday, May 21, 2024, 12:21 GMT

See the above discussion. Pirate Guy is only the name of an enemy from Yoshi's Island DS, but this article rambles on about every time Shy Guys have ever been seen in pirate clothes, including the Mario Party ones which are only ever called Shy Guys, not treating them as a distinct entity, making this wiki's classification of them as Pirate Guys speculative at best.

There are multiple options for cleaning this up, based on commenters' suggestions and my own:

  • Option 1: Merge Yoshi's Story and Mario Kart content with Shy Guy Galleon, merge Mario Party content with Shy Guy: The Shy Guy Galleon article currently only covers the Shy Guy Beach ship, but the YS one very similar to it. Though the ship's design is different, the Shy Guys on board look similar and it shares the MK one's schtick of launching stuff at the player from the background (Bob-ombs in Story, cannonballs in Kart).
  • Option 2: Split Story content to Kaizokusen Heihō, merge Kart content with Shy Guy Galleon, merge Party content with Shy Guy: Similar to the above, but splits the YS to its own article under its unique Japanese name.
  • Option 3: Merge with Shy Guy entirely: From what I understand, Pirate Guys in Yoshi's Island DS actually behave identically to regular Shy Guys, with the only distinction being their outfit, and they are only named by guides. Given that and the lack of a real source for the other games' Shy Guy pirates being anything but Shy Guys in a specific role, so we could just merge the thing outright.
  • Option 4: Leave as is: Self-explanatory.
